The article examines the interaction between innovation policy and its determinants on the example of Sweden. Initially, Sweden owed its innovativeness to right socio-political conditions, but the process of globalization has forced change in innovation policy paradigm, which is since the 90s twentieth century, actively shaping the institutional environment of enterprises. Similar changes are most likely a prerequisite for maintaining high innovativeness of the Swedish economy in the face of the current economic crisis.

Przedmiotem analizy są stosowane obecnie w Polsce instrumenty wsparcia innowacyjności. Celem artykułu jest próba odpowiedzi na pytanie: Czy i w jakim stopniu poszczególne instrumenty ułatwiają przedsiębiorstwom /przedsiębiorcom podejmowanie i prowadzenie działalności innowacyjnej? Przeanalizowane są kolejno narzędzia adresowane do firm bezpośrednio i pośrednio. Wyniki analizy nie pozwalają, niestety, na udzielenie pozytywnej odpowiedzi na tytułowe pytanie. Na zakończenie podjęta jest próba ustalenia przyczyn takiego stanu rzeczy.
The main aim of this paper is an attempt to answer the question whether the existing public policy instruments in Poland are useful (helpful) for enterprises/entrepreneurs who intend to start or develop their innovation activities. The tools addressed directly and indirectly to firms are here deeply analyzed. Unfortunately, the results of this analysis do not allow us to give a positive answer to this question.

When taking actions to promote the competitiveness of a given country or group, the benefi ts of higher growth and dynamic development should be reaped by all members of a given community or group and, thus, this growth should be inclusive. The aim of the paper is to present the role of the innovation policy in fostering inclusive growth in China and in the EU. It is arguable that this policy should, in particular, support the growth of inclusive innovation irrespective of the level or value of the economic growth of a given country. However, given the diverse conditions of each country and, thus, different issues to be tackled, inclusive innovation must consider how unique such countries are. Supporting and developing inclusive innovation is not only the exclusive policy of developing countries such as China. In the EU, fostering this kind of innovation is highly encouraged, which contributes to achieving sustainable growth and ensuring benefits from inclusive innovations to EU inhabitants given that this is the major priority of this union and the foundation on which further continued growth of the EU is built.

Adopting and developing a knowledge-based economy as the current stage of global economic development is an important stimulus to successful innovation. The transition to a knowledge-based economy and achieving economic convergence, especially in the case of emerging economies, requires the appreciation of science and technology coexistence on the one hand, and the development of innovation on the other, as well as the raising of human resource competences and skills for further development. Latin American countries, in search of an effective development strategy after moving away from the Washington Consensus, which set economic priorities through the last decade of the twentieth century, become increasingly aware of the importance of the development of STI policies. They try to identify the most important institutions and the capacities and resources needed to support economic development. Such policy generally includes at least three objectives: to create research and development opportunities in public research institutes and universities; to stimulate the demand of companies for scientific and technological knowledge by establishing close relationships between universities, business and government, and supporting and developing national innovation systems in each country. In this article the author analyzes the policies introduced and attempts to assess their effectiveness.

An innovation-driven agenda in regional development policy has emerged in the European Union against the backdrop of peripheralisation, especially in Central and Eastern Europe. Using a discursive analytical framework, the article investigates the ways in which peripheralisation is manifested through language, practices and power-rationalities in Estonian innovation policy discourse. The analysis is footed on key strategic policy documents and semistructured expert interviews. Findings suggest that Estonian innovation policy’s main narrative of the ‘knowledge-based economy’ accepts growing disparities on sub-national level in order to overcome peripherality at European scale and narrows the range of policy solutions perceived as suitable.

Objectives: The rising popularity of Innovation Public Procurement (IPP) raises questions about its effectiveness as a tool for transformative policies, including governance levels, coordination, and strategic development. The purpose of the article is to explore the failure of governance in a Polish IPP to present how IPP guidelines are implemented empirically. Research Design & Methods: The research article presents conclusions from the case study of first large-scale trial of public procurement procedure with respect to an innovative partnership in Poland. Findings: The case is a rarely analysed example of policy failure and shows that ignoring stakeholders’ needs, timeline constrains, and market capacity can result in policy failure. Programme history highlights that proper risk analysis and adaptation to the market context can prevent programme failure. Implications/Recommendations: The article opens up a field for considering what steps are crucial in formulating IPP, especially in country with lower level of innovativeness. The analysis leads to the main conclusion that transformative policy frameworks using demand-pull tools need to be embedded in the market realities and capabilities of national innovation systems. Contribution/Value Added: The article strives to fill a gap in the literature on implementing transformational innovation policies in peripheral countries, which are less frequently described. The other contributions refer to merging the DARPA’s approach and IPP.

The article investigates changes of national innovativeness and state’s innovation policy under conditions of open economy. An external openness – to the global environment – enables growth of international flows of goods and factors as well as increase of business and institutional linkages. Raising importance and impacts of external conditions on national innovativeness and national innovation system (NIS) are driven by four processes: globalization, regionalization, growing knowledge-based economy and transnational business. A new concept of NIS internationalization process in an open economy is introduced, including external and internal conditions, four groups of entities (including ones of foreign origin) together with their linkages and interactions. The return of the state to active innovation policy in order to influence activity led by all entities of domestic as well as foreign origins, including subsidiaries and research centers owned by foreign firms (TNCs) is justified in the light of the research. The state should influence the activity led by foreign entities with instruments of investment policy (to attract inflow of foreign direct investments to the domestic research sector) as well as instruments of innovation policy directed towards all entities.

The purpose of this article is analysis of innovation policy, understood as a factor conditioning the institutional and organizational efficiency and effectiveness of the National System of Innovation (NSI), suggesting desirable areas of state intervention in relation to the NSI in Poland. The article consists of four parts. The first part presents the stages in the development of innovation policy and recognizes the links between innovation policy and the development of research on innovation processes. The second part presents potential areas of state intervention and the main instruments used within the framework of innovation policy. The third part presents the theory of NSI which – while referring to the links between various NSI elements – indicates a wide range of potential possibilities of indirect support for innovation processes. The last part identifies the areas of state intervention which are important from the point of view of Poland’s NSI development.

Activities and instruments of innovation policy in the microenterprenuers opinion The paper contains the research results on the activities and instruments used by government istitutions in the implementation of innovation policy. The aim of the study was to identify and evaluate the key activities and instruments, which had an impact on microterprises innovativeness in Warmia and Mazury region. Key activities of public organizations, which had an impact on the microenterprises innovativeness were: reduction the law encumbarance administrative on businesses (including microenterprises), intensification and expanding the role of consultation in creating the law, creation secure information networks and systems and e-commerce promotion. The most important instruments for the implementation innovation policy, wchich used by the public were: loans for purposes related to the business, training about external financing innovation and access to constantly updated databases (eg. knowledge, best practices).
